Understanding Cyber Hygiene: A Modern Life Skill

Cyber hygiene consists of daily habits, precautionary strategies, and core practices that protect users’ devices and personal information online. According to the National Institute of Standards and Technology (NIST), cyber hygiene is “the practice of maintaining proper security measures and behaviors to protect oneself online and ensure cybersecurity.” Just as personal hygiene guards physical health, robust cyber hygiene maintains digital well-being by preventing malware, unauthorized access, and data breaches.

Cyber hygiene and digital literacy intersect at a crucial educational juncture. Digital literacy enables students to find, assess, and share digital information, while cyber hygiene focuses on the security, privacy, and safety of their digital engagements. The Center for Digital Education stresses that both skill sets are foundational for students to access the benefits of digital learning environments securely.

Mounting evidence underscores the pivotal nature of these skills. A 2023 Pew Research Center study revealed that 92% of teachers regard digital literacy as “essential” for academic achievement, with 87% specifically highlighting online safety knowledge. Further, the National Center for Education Statistics indicates that students with strong digital safety skills outperform their peers academically by 28%.

Current Digital Threats in Educational Environments

Today’s students face a rapidly evolving array of digital risks, including:

  • Cyberattacks on educational institutions: Microsoft Security Intelligence found a 29% increase in cyberattacks targeting schools during 2022-2023, with K-12 schools especially vulnerable to ransomware and data breaches.
  • Personal data breaches: The Identity Theft Resource Center reported 408 data breaches at educational institutions in 2022 alone, compromising approximately 1.5 million student records with sensitive information.
  • Social engineering: The FBI’s Internet Crime Complaint Center documented a 34% surge in social engineering attacks focused on school-age children in 2023, with phishing attempts aiming to steal credentials and financial data.
  • Cyberbullying: The Cyberbullying Research Center reports that 46% of teens have experienced some form of cyberbullying. This directly affects academic performance, self-esteem, and attendance.

The consequences of these threats reach beyond the digital realm, impacting students’ emotional well-being, learning outcomes, and sense of security. As schools continue integrating digital tools, failure to address cyber hygiene leaves critical gaps in student protection and educational quality.

Educational Equity Implications

The digital divide today extends beyond device and internet access. It also includes disparities in cyber safety education and awareness. According to Common Sense Media, students from lower-income communities are 37% less likely to receive formal training in online safety and privacy, reinforcing existing inequalities.

Dr. Safiya Noble, an expert in digital ethics, emphasizes, “Digital literacy is not a luxury but a civil right in an era where civic, social, and economic participation increasingly depend on digital competency.” When schools overlook cyber hygiene, they inadvertently widen achievement gaps, leaving the most vulnerable students at heightened risk.

Core Components of Effective Online Safety Education

Building a comprehensive cyber hygiene program requires an intentional blend of essential skills and practices. Models developed by organizations such as the International Society for Technology in Education (ISTE) and the National Cyber Security Alliance provide guidance for schools seeking to establish or strengthen their curricula.

Essential Curriculum Elements

  • Digital identity management: Training students to build positive, secure online identities and understand the implications of sharing personal details.
  • Critical evaluation skills: Teaching strategies for identifying credible information, spotting misinformation, and understanding manipulative digital tactics.
  • Technical security basics: Practical instruction on creating strong passwords, enabling two-factor authentication, securing devices, and using safe networks.
  • Online ethics and responsibility: Exploring digital citizenship, etiquette, and the long-term consequences of online actions, including legal considerations.
  • Privacy protection: Educating about how data is collected and shared and showing students how to use privacy settings and maintain control over their information.

Age-Appropriate Progression Framework

A successful cyber hygiene curriculum evolves as students grow. The scope and complexity of lessons should increase with maturity:

Elementary School (K-5)

  • Introducing basic safety boundaries online versus offline
  • Teaching age-appropriate password habits
  • Recognizing personal information and learning what should stay private
  • Identifying trustworthy adults and help-seeking behaviors

Middle School (6-8)

  • Responsible social media use and privacy control
  • Understanding digital footprints and long-term consequences of posts
  • Recognizing and responding to cyberbullying
  • Exploring basic security technology (e.g., encryption)
  • Building skills in online reputation management

High School (9-12)

  • Identifying sophisticated cyber threats (such as phishing and scams)
  • Advancing personal data protection strategies
  • Debating the ethical and legal implications of online conduct
  • Deep-diving into digital privacy, surveillance, and data rights
  • Developing a professional online presence for college or career

This spiraling framework ensures that students revisit foundational concepts with increasing depth, fostering both retention and relevance as technology and threats evolve.

Connection to Career Readiness

According to the World Economic Forum, cybersecurity and digital proficiency are now required skills across nearly all professions. Their reports indicate that 94% of employers view cyber hygiene knowledge as a baseline competency for entry-level roles, not just technology jobs.

Practical examples demonstrate this demand across industries:

  • Healthcare: Future healthcare workers need to apply cyber hygiene practices to safeguard electronic health records, maintain device security, and comply with laws such as HIPAA (in the US) or GDPR (in the EU).
  • Finance: Banking professionals must understand data security, fraud prevention, and encryption basics to maintain customer trust and comply with regulations.
  • Education: Teachers and administrators rely on cyber safety to protect student data and facilitate safe digital learning.
  • Legal: Attorneys and paralegals manage sensitive information daily, requiring strong data privacy and cybersecurity awareness.
  • Marketing and retail: Professionals need to ensure the security of online transactions, customer databases, and e-commerce platforms.
  • Environmental science and resource management: Researchers use secure networks and practices when handling sensitive environmental data.

The need for cyber hygiene is universal. As Dr. Nicol Turner Lee at Brookings explains, “Digital literacy moved from specialized technical training to a universal foundation for workforce readiness across all sectors.”

From Theory to Practice: Implementing Cyber Hygiene Programs

Translating concept into classroom reality requires strategic integration and ongoing evaluation. Effective approaches include both dedicated instruction and embedded, cross-curricular engagement.

Implementation Strategies

Dedicated Courses: Some school districts have adopted cyber hygiene as a standalone subject, offering courses starting as early as elementary and expanding into semester-long or full-credit offerings in middle and high school, including advanced electives on cybersecurity fundamentals.

Curriculum Integration: Embedding cyber safety themes across existing subjects (like social studies, science, language arts, and digital arts) improves student engagement and retention. For example, students can explore the ethics of information sharing in social studies or password management during practical computer lessons. The Journal of Technology Education reports that cross-curricular integration results in 47% higher retention rates compared to isolated cyber safety lessons.

Community Partnerships and Teacher Training: Collaborations with cybersecurity professionals, local industry leaders, and nonprofit organizations can provide real-world case studies, resources, and up-to-date guidance. Regular professional development ensures educators remain confident role models for digital best practices.

Parental Outreach: Providing parents and guardians with resources, workshops, and policy updates extends cyber hygiene habits beyond the classroom, supporting digital safety in the home.
